Returning (Melee Weapon Magic Property)

Enchant Cost: +0

This magic weapon property can only be placed on melee weapons that are designed to be thrown (that is, a melee weapon that has a numeric value in its Range column), or on weapons with the Throwing property. This property cannot be applied to ammunition or any weapon with the expendable quality.

A returning weapon teleports instantly back to the creature that threw it immediately after it strikes its target. This allows the thrower to make multiple attacks during a full attack action with a single returning weapon. Catching a returning weapon when it comes back is a free action. If the character can't catch it, or if the character has moved since throwing it, the weapon drops to the ground in the square from which it was thrown.

Special: This property cannot be added 'for free' to any weapon. The weapon must have at least a +1 enhancement bonus, or a +1 property, in order to give the weapon a base enchantment which then allows this property to be added for free if desired. Further properties on the thrown weapon do not cost more because of this free property, nor does it count against the maximum number of magic properties a weapon can have.

Creation: Creator (Feat), Bailiwick Check (DC 16), a languid remnant (tier 1), and an item symbolic of the enchantment.
